    Job description

    R&D Specialist II YOUR TASKS AND RESPONSIBILITIES You will identify and validate molecular targets that play a key role in plant pathology, yield, and nutrition. Also, you will analyze and identify the biological, chemical, and genetic properties of plants. Additionally, you will study molecular biology, cell biology, plant genetics, plant physiology, biochemistry, and/or microbiology as input to the discovery of new plant cultivars or agricultural methods.

    Finally, you may conduct research on insect neurochemistry and pheromones for pest control. The primary responsibilities of this role, R&D Specialist II, are to: Work collaboratively with other greenhouse and lab team members to deliver daily and weekly production targets under tight deadlines, identify opportunities for system or process improvements, operate automation, and perform experiments; Have primary or shared responsibility for a specialized laboratory and controlled environment technology; Prepare reports of an analytical and interpretative nature; Train and may supervise others in specialized areas; Interact with others within specialized areas; Organize and put together reports; Problem solve using original thinking and deductive reasoning of diverse procedures within specialized laboratory technology; Conduct complex activities that require the application of specialized scientific techniques; Take initiative to keep current with developments in specialized area; Work closely with work teams and support functional spaces within the Plant Biology Hub; Interact with all collaborating functional spaces within Plant Biotechnology as well as potential spaces within Crop Protection, Regulatory Science, and Breeding; Potentially collaborate with external partners on system improvements. WHO YOU ARE Bayer seeks an incumbent who possesses the following: Required Qualifications: High School Diploma; Strong horticultural production knowledge; Ability to independently design experiments and analyze data; Greenhouse/growth chamber experience; Ability to identify, communicate, track, and troubleshoot plant health variables; Proficiency with data analysis and visualization software.

    Preferred Qualifications: Master's degree with minimum years of relevant experience; OR Bachelor's degree with a minimum of 2+ years of relevant experience; OR High School Diploma with 10 years of relevant experience.
